A maker-space is a community workshop where people from a variety of different disciplines gather to create new ideas and items. Being able to rapidly prototype and test new concepts provides an ideal environment to facilitate the creative process. Our array of 3D-printers, laser cutter, and electronics work stations provide the tools required to accomplish this. In addition, our organization offers an environment that encourages collaboration, mentorship, and knowledge sharing.
